pub struct ChannelCapabilities {
pub supports_async: bool,
pub supports_rich_media: bool,
pub supports_threads: bool,
}Expand description
Describes what a ReviewChannel implementation supports.
Fields§
§supports_async: boolWhether the channel supports async responses (human responds later, not inline).
supports_rich_media: boolWhether the channel supports rich media (images, formatted diffs, etc.).
supports_threads: boolWhether the channel supports threaded discussions.
Trait Implementations§
Source§impl Clone for ChannelCapabilities
impl Clone for ChannelCapabilities
Source§fn clone(&self) -> ChannelCapabilities
fn clone(&self) -> ChannelCapabilities
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ChannelCapabilities
impl Debug for ChannelCapabilities
Source§impl Default for ChannelCapabilities
impl Default for ChannelCapabilities
Source§fn default() -> ChannelCapabilities
fn default() -> ChannelCapabilities
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for ChannelCapabilities
impl<'de> Deserialize<'de> for ChannelCapabilities
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for ChannelCapabilities
impl RefUnwindSafe for ChannelCapabilities
impl Send for ChannelCapabilities
impl Sync for ChannelCapabilities
impl Unpin for ChannelCapabilities
impl UnsafeUnpin for ChannelCapabilities
impl UnwindSafe for ChannelCapabilities
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more